SPECTACULAR WESBANK V8 SUPERCAR
RACING AT KILLARNEY
Close high speed racing, spectacular crashes, a blown engine
coating the Killarney Circuit with oil, and reigning WesBank
V8 Supercar Champion, Hennie Groenewald, (Havoline Jaguar),
winning both the 8 lap sprint and the reverse grid 12 lapper,
to tie for the lead on the points table with Kyalami winner,
Grant van Schalkwyk (Hi-Q Jaguar), sums up some of the WesBank
racing at Cape Town on Saturday.
Race 1 saw Groenewald from pole position lead the way with van
Schalkwyk, Marc Auby (Masana Petroleum Jaguar), Mackie Adlem
(Fuchs Lubricants Ford) and Zane Pearce (Hi-Q Jaguar) and
Jimmy Auby (Jonnesway Bosal Jaguar) in close attendance.
Suddenly Jaco Correia (Omega Spares Corvette) popped a V8
motor, causing mayhem with oil making the track unraceable. In
the meantime Larry Wilford (Fuchs Lubricants Mustang), had
gone off the road in the oil and Zane Pearce (Hi-Q Jaguar) had
a heavy coming together with Vernon Bricknell (Nationwide
Jaguar), putting him out for the day.
The race was red-flagged after 3 laps.
At the re-start for a new race of 6 laps, Groenewald made no
mistake. He romped into the lead and won by nearly 3 seconds.
Mackie Adlem, doing a fine job of keeping van Schalkwyk behind
him on every corner, came home 2nd. Then came Jimmy Auby,
Larry Wilford and Gordon Connelly (Dezzi/Cowan Signs Jaguar)
in a bad handling car in 6th.
The 12 lapper saw the fastest 8 drivers swop grid positions,
with van Schalkwyk and Groenewald starting from 7th and 8th
place. Engen VW Polo Champion, Robert Briggs (Timken Jaguar),
and Larry Wilford made the running at the front, until van
Schalkwyk and Groenewald arrived in a hurry. Groenewald passed
van Schalkwyk and went to the front at the Cape Town corner
with a few laps to go, after what he described as an enjoyable
race. Behind these two came Jimmy Auby, Connelly, Pearce and
Wilford, posting the second fastest lap of the race. Adlem
retired when a wheel rim failed. Richard Pinnard (Team
Permatex Jaguar) had diff trouble, and Jaco Correia went off
the road at Damps Dip and retired.
RESULTS
RACE 1 1st Groenewald, 2nd Adlem, 3rd van Schalkwyk,
4th Jimmy Auby, 5th Larry Wilford, 6th Gordon Connelly
RACE 2 1st Groenewald, 2nd van Schalkwyk, 3rd Jimmy Auby,
4th Connelly, 5th Zane Pearce, 6th Wilford |
